WebJun 22, 2024 · This is fairly similar to 1 1 − x, for which we know a power series: 1 1 − x = 1 + x + x2 +... = ∞ ∑ k=0xk The radius of convergence for this power series is x ∈ ( − 1,1). While it would be easy to say that 1 (1 − x)2 = ( ∞ ∑ k=0xk)2 This is not a valid representation of a power series. Usually, some power series arise from derivatives.
